Ruh, Heidi L.
Army Sergeant

Heidi L. Ruh, age 32, from Kiel, Wisconsin.

Parents: Cathi and Scott Ruh
Children: Son, 8; son, 11

Service era: Afghanistan
Schools: Kiel High graduate
Military history: Based in Fort Hood, Texas.

Date of death: Friday, May 9, 2014
Death details: Ruh’s body was found by a civilian at a running track at Camp Bondsteel in Kosovo.

Source: Green Bay Press Gazette, Meiselwitz-Vollstedt Funeral Home

Summers, Eric W.
Marines Staff sergeant

Eric W. Summers, age 32, from Poplar Bluff, Missouri, Butler county.

Service era: Afghanistan
Military history: Enlisted July 2000.

Date of death: Monday, November 13, 2013
Death details: Killed in an explosion during range maintenance operations to dispose of unexploded ordnance in the Zulu impact area aboard Marine Corps Base Camp Pendleton. Killed were Gunnery Sgt. Gregory J. Mullins, Staff Sgt. Mathew R. Marsh, Staff Sgt. Eric W. Summers and Sgt. Miguel Ortiz.

Source: cbs8.com, Missourinet

Anderson, Nathan W.
Marines Captain

Nathan W. Anderson, age 32, from Amarillo, Texas.

Service era: Afghanistan
Military history: Based in Yuma, Arizona.

Date of death: Wednesday, February 22, 2012
Death details: Died when an AH-1W Cobra and a UH-1 Huey helicopters crashed during a routine training exercise along the California-Arizona broder. All aboard were killed. They were: Maj. Thomas A. Budrejko, Capt. Michael M. Quin, Capt. Benjamin N. Cerniglia, Sgt. Justin A. Everett, Lance Cpl Corey A. Little, Lance Cpl Nickoulas H. Elliott, Capt. Nathan W. Anderson.

Source: Associated Press, findagrave.com

Metzger, Jonathan M.
Army Staff sergeant

Jonathan M. Metzger, age 32, from Indianapolis, Indiana, Marion county.

Service era: Afghanistan
Military history: National Guard, Valparaiso-based 713th Engineer Company.

Date of death: Thursday, January 5, 2012
Death details: Died in southern Afghanistan when his vehicle struck a roadside bomb while his unit worked to clear a supply route of improvised bombs. Killed were Staff Sgt. Jonathan M. Metzger, Spc. Brian J. Leonhardt, Spc. Robert J. Tauteris Jr., and Spc. Christopher A. Patterson

Source: Associated Press, Military Times
